Mobile Phone Shops near Haggerston Tube & Rail Station

Need a Mobile Phone Shop near Haggerston?
Kings Gadgets image
Kings Gadgets
292 Kingsland Road E8 4DG
Haggerston 0.35 miles
Mobile Phone Shops
Page 1 of 1